chapter one

recovered scrolls found by great explorers team 1 (forest team)

"we have traveled a great distance from our homes already. we have fought our way past vicious and dangerous beasts after coming down a steep and dangerous climb. now here at this camp we write these messages for any who may risk the travels as we have, or perhaps for future generations to find as they travel back to where we came from.
the master crafter's with us have created a set of jewels, armor, and daggers to leave with these writings. these items have been made with the very best materials we have. the master crafter's used the most secret crafting skills known to our people to make these items. we hope that whoever may find these will put them to good use and respect the effort and dedication it took to make them."

the items were shown to those in power as proof after being displayed to the homins of the forest lands. solid proof of their tales because there's nothing like these items that has been ever seen before.

chapter two

recovered scrolls found by great explorers team 2 (desert team)

"after the long distance we have already traveled from our homes we are making camp to put our story into words that we hope will one day be read. our trials have been full of dangers, from the vicious and dangerous beasts we have fought to the long and dangerous climb down the steep path. even after the climb we have found ourselves still in danger of vicious creatures, though it's our fortune that they do not attack us here like in our home lands. here the attacks are random and not as often when we are in one place. we encounter more attacks when we travel but that's to be expected as we are much more exposed and on the move. the attacks that do come are quickly defeated by the master hunters and warriors in our group of travelers.
we have set out from our homelands in search of a safer place to live. in these last few months at home our cities were being attacked more and more often by large packs of vicious creatures. it wasn't uncommon to encounter these creatures far from the city, but lately they've been attacking the cities. with every day that passed the attacks became more frequent and the groups of creatures larger. at the time of our departure the attacks were getting so bad that we had to seek shelter when they happened. only the hunters and warriors would remain outside to fight. soon it was so bad that a new course of action had to be taken. at that time it was decided that we would take a large group of homins willing to risk the dangers outside the city to seek out a new land to call home. one that might be safer then our homeland had recently become.
now here we all are writing this down for someone to read. the jewels we are leaving with these scrolls are the very best our master jewel crafter can make. he is one of the last of the great masters of jewel craft in our land, this set may be his legacy should things go badly in our future. we have chosen to leave it here in the hope that one day someone will find it and put them to good use. what the future will hold for us after we leave these scrolls behind is a mystery to all of us."

the items were shown to those in power as proof after being displayed to the homins of the desert lands. solid proof of their tales because there's nothing like these items has ever been seen before.

chapter three

recovered scrolls found by great explorers team 3 (lakes team)

"after sad events recently we have chosen to write down a short history of events leading to this point.
our homeland and cities had been under siege from large groups of very viscous, violent, and dangerous creatures. at first the attacks were only small numbers and quickly put down. as time went on the attacks grew in both frequency as well as the numbers in the groups attacking. even as the attacks grew more common and the groups larger, we continued to defend against them with good results, at least in the beginning. over time it was getting harder to stop the attacks in the lands outside the cities.
it was agreed that we would be safer and more protected to stay within the cities and defend them from attack with more concentrated forces. for a time this was a very effective method of protection and defense from the attacking creatures. it soon proved to be less then enough.
first one city was overwhelmed by the creatures and the homins there were forced to escape to the nearest city for refuge, the combined force of the evacuating warriors, hunters, crafter's, harvesters, and unskilled homins that survived the escape with those in the city which they fled to were able to defend the pursuing creatures. it wasn't long after that there was another large scale attack on this safe-haven. this attack was the most fierce one yet. while the city did not fall there were massive losses. there was an emergency meeting of the remaining cities, with brave messengers taking each city decision to the next. after each city had come to realize how grave the loss of the first city and the following attack on the second city was there was only a single logical path to take at that time, move everyone into a single city where the mass of forces could perhaps repel the attacks of these creatures. shortly after this was decided upon there was a massive movement from three of the four remaining cities, with the fourth city being the city where everyone would live and make their stand.
for some time this was effective against the attacks of the creatures. slowly there was a growing concern that each attack was larger in numbers then the last, and that at some point we would run the risk of being out numbered and over-run. it was with these foreboding thoughts that a new plan was devised. that plan is what lead us to where we are now as we write this, simply put, we took a small group of willing homins out of the city with the plan to go beyond the known borders of our land in search of a new land to safely live in.
after traveling beyond the known borders of our homeland we came to a dangerous and steep climb before us. looking out from our high vantage point we could see land below us, a land that was until that moment unknown to all in our land. we could see that there was a chance to work our way down a narrow path, while we could see no creatures upon the path before us, there were still creatures that had been following us and making attempts to catch us off guard. while they had yet to do any real harm to us other then slow us down, they were a constraint reminder of what was behind us.
it was decided that we would risk the narrow climb down no matter how steep or how dangerous it would be, for staying there would mean certain death from the creatures if their numbers grew too large to defend. once the long climb down was over we found ourselves on new lands much like those of our home, at least by it's looks. a few of the following creatures had tried to follow us down the climb, but they were few in numbers and quickly killed. we made our first camp in these new lands at the bottom of the path from above to decide what to do next.
that night while we rested we were attacked by a small group of aggressive creatures, nothing like what we had fought in our homeland though. it was decided then that we would keep a watch even in these new lands as we moved looking for a new place to call home. for days we moved and fought small groups of these aggressive creatures, with little fear to loosing, these were nothing like the beasts that had drove us from our homelands. we were perhaps over confident, and would soon find it would be fatal to some of us.
one day after setting up camp it was decided that we would send out a few small teams to collect things we needed. we sent several hunters and warriors in each team, leaving they younger and newer of the hunters and warriors and elders of the crafter's at the camp. each of the teams we sent out was to collect food, materials to craft with, and a team to scout the area to decide where to go next. while those teams were gone on their various missions there was an attack on the camp.
the attack on the camp must have been larger then those prior to that day. it's our belief based on what we found upon the return of the teams we sent out that it was indeed a vicious fight, though none survived the attack in the end. we had lost some of the greatest crafter's our people had ever known.
it was the tragedy of that day that we decided it best to tell our tale and leave it behind with some of the greatest items crafted by those that were lost. while these items were made to be used to protect us on our journey we had decided that it best to leave them behind with these scrolls. perhaps one day they will be found, and then used as they were made to be used or given to a new generation of master crafter's to try to unlock the secrets that went to the grave with the passing of our great crafter.
it's our hope that these scrolls will one day be found and read and that our story can be told."

the items were shown to those in power as proof after being displayed to the homins of the lake lands. solid proof of their tales because there's nothing like these items has ever seen before.

chapter four

recovered scrolls found by great explorers team 4 (jungle team)

"we have left our homes in our known land above where we are now. the travels have been long and dangerous every step of the way to this point. we've build a camp to rest and take time to write a short history of our people in the lands above this place we now find ourselves in. it's hard to know where to start at or what things to deam worthy of putting in our writings.
i guess the history of our people doesn't matter at this point because that is all it will ever be at this time, a history. there is no hope of returning to our land that we can foresee, it's become far too dangerous. bandits had grown in numbers in the past few years, and they were a grave danger to peaceful homins. they had made many attempts to attack the cities with no success.
to further make our lands dangerous the wild creatures have grown even more dangerous in recent seasons. they too began to make life in our lands a difficult one. as they grew in numbers they also grew in strength and aggressiveness. it wasn't long till the creatures began to chase homins longer and longer distances, many homins died as a result.
as the risks grew it was clear that between the bandits and the dangerous creatures our lands were becoming far too hostile to trek outside the cities. as fewer and fewer homins were leaving the cities as a result of these new dangers attacks on the cities from creatures started to occure. at first they were easily repelled, but over time they grew more vicious and in larger numbers. it was thought that perhaps the bandits had something to do with this but there was never any way to prove or disprove it.
soon the homins of our lands were confined to the cities only, and the only travel between them was a very dangerous one that required large groups. attacks continued upon the cities from the creatures, and with each attack they grew in intensity. it was decided that all homins in the smaller cities would move to our capital city for safety in numbers.
there was a slowing of attacks from creatures for a time, but it was a short one. once again the attacks started to happen more often and the creatures were attacking in ever growing numbers and strength.
the wise homins and elders came together to decide what to do next. the elders decided that there would be a request for homins that were willing to attempt to leave our known lands in search of new lands to live in. the hope was that we would find safer lands to live our lives in, one where we could grow and prosper without fear.
our journey from the city was not a quick one, nor was it safe or easy. every step of the way was a fight for our lives, as we reached the borders of our lands the dangers lessened some, and we were able to relax a little as we traveled. a short time after we reached the edges of our known lands, and from that point on it was a venture into the unknown.
after a few days of travel beyond the borders we found ourselves at the edge of a long downward path. the sight we beheld at this point was like nothing we had ever seen before. we could see a huge landscape far below us, and it was then that we realized that we were far above the surface of our world. we rested for a day and started the dangerous climb down to the surface we could see below us.
for 3 days we traveled downward, carefully trying to find our way around the obsticals that lay before us on this steep and dangerous path. one wrong step could have meant certain death for anyone in our group, perhaps taking others with us. as we worked our way down the path slowly turned less tretrous, but only slightly. on the forth day we reached this point we're now writing this.
with these scrolls we're also going to leave the finest set's of armor, magical amplifiers, jewels, and a dagger and axe set. the armor was crafted by one the greatest crafters in the land we left behind, and created in the hopes that it would provide more then just protection from attacks. the amplifiers came from the only crafter known to know the secrets that would provide a increase of power over double the caster's ability at over double the speed. the jewels were crafted by a jewel crafter that only shared her knowledge with one other, the knowledge of how to increase the health of the wearer more then then any other jeweler could. the dagger and axe set was made as a one of a kind set by the greatest weapon crafter in known history, they were made so that a homin could use both the dagger and the axe at the same time and with a speed that could not be beat.
we've left these items behind in the hope that with the scrolls they would show whoever might find them what our dedications to our skills could allow a homin to do."

the items were shown to those in power as proof after being displayed to the homins of the jungle lands. solid proof of their tales because there's nothing like these items has ever seen before.
